Does anyone out there in the group know
why Minute Rice is not on the glutenfree
list from CSA/USA?  I called the company
and they don't find any gluten in the rice.
I use the 10 minute brown rice which is
very tasty.  I have never run into a problem with it.  I know that
different brands of rice are not sold all over the US
but have different names from the same
company.  Could it be that in the process
it gets cross-contaminated with gluten?
The man I contacted at the company did
not know the answer to this question and
said he doubted if anyone could supply me
with this info.  I find that strange.
What's the top secret.  The bottom line
is it doesn't seem to affect me and I eat
a lot of brown rice.  Anyone else out there
have a comment on this brand or others?
Thanks in advance.  Rosalie
